SMC’s most exciting news this year is the new Cardiovascular and Thoracic Surgery program that opened on campus Sept. 1. Bringing greater access to specialized open heart, vascular and thoracic procedures for our community, Dr. R. Lewis Wilson, Jr., and Dr. Charles H. Wyatt are outstanding leaders in their specialties and will further build the program from their new office in SMC’s Heart Center.

Springhill Medical had a unique opportunity to bring these two surgeons to campus to establish a campus-based program, so a large team of medical and support personnel worked hard to get everything ready for the September launch.

“We consider this a major update to our well-established, excellent cardiac and surgical service lines,” explains Mr. Jeff St. Clair, SMC President/CEO. “We’ll have a much needed program for the community based right here on our hospital campus, and we’ll be in an incredible position to continue the growth of those services. These are the best doctors we could hope to work with for this venture, and we’re extremely excited to have them here.”

Dr. Wilson will lead the new Cardiovascular and Thoracic program at SMC. He is a former Lt. Commander in the U.S. Naval Reserves and is board certified in surgery, thoracic surgery and vascular surgery. He is fellowship trained in general thoracic surgery and vascular surgery. He previously served as medical director of the peripheral vascular lab, cardiovascular intensive care unit, and cardiovascular surgical services at Cookeville Regional Medical Center in Tennessee. He has earned numerous honors, held several hospital appointments, and has led multiple presentations.

Dr. Wyatt is board certified in surgery and thoracic surgery and is fellowship trained in thoracic surgery. He was responsible for building hospital-based cardiovascular and thoracic programs in the Pensacola area and in Louisiana. Prior to joining Springhill Medical, he also served in leadership roles with a large health system representing Florida on the National Cardiovascular Surgery Service Line work group for the last six years and prior worked as Chief Medical Officer for a local Louisiana HCA hospital. He has earned numerous awards and honors over his lengthy medical career, has held several political appointed positions, and founded the “Be A Heartstarter” annual mass bystander CPR training event in Lafayette among his lengthy list of community work.

In addition to all of this, the physicians continue to share their wealth of knowledge in key training sessions and in published works for the medical community. Both of these multidiscipline, fellowship-trained experts are dedicated to providing comprehensive cardiac, thoracic, and vascular care at Springhill.
